Role summary

As the Equipment Manager, you will take ownership of the team’s equipment operations in a contract, on-site capacity. This includes organizing, maintaining, and preparing gear for practices and games so that players and staff have what they need at all times.

Key duties

You will set up and prepare uniforms and equipment such as jerseys, protective gear, sticks, and goalie items for practices and game days. The role also involves checking equipment condition, cleaning items, and carrying out minor fixes, including skate sharpening, replacing laces and straps, and small stitching repairs. You will keep inventory records accurate, monitor equipment usage, manage storage spaces, and arrange ordering or replacement of supplies within an assigned budget. In addition, you will partner with coaches, players, and other staff to respond quickly to equipment requests, support travel arrangements and game-day logistics, and keep locker room and bench areas neat and aligned with league expectations.
